“Tianbao” Wendan Pomelo, British special product, well-known in Sichuan Province as a fine pomelo, is in ball-like shape with a weight of 4 or 5 grams, whose pulp is tender, easy-chewing, juicy, sweet and fragrant, and shell is granularly oil-pot and translucent jade. When touched it gives off sweet perfume, and when pierced, it is juicy and sweeter. In winter when ripe, it is yellow, fleshy and sweet without bitter or puckery taste, and its perfume of peel will linger for days.
